Rear door not being recognized as open

So when I open the rear right door the truck does not recognize it at all. The lights also dont work on that door when any door is open. I tested the wires at the light and I have 12v but the ground is not there. I am wondering if these 2 issues are related and how I would go about trouble shooting them.

Probably related. Check the switch on that door. Contacts may be dirty or, it could be a faulty switch. Not sure on the T4R but, a lot of cars have constant power to the switch and only when the door is open does it make ground.

Yes I did remove the switch but it looks fine I guess I can order one and swap it that might resolve the issue.

It’s sounds like you have a meter, use it to ohm out that switch and see if it makes out breaks the circuit, would save you time and money vs throwing parts at it
